    You’re in a Zoom meeting, trying to listen attentively while taking notes on everything important. Halfway through, you realize you’ve missed half of it. Fireflies solves that problem by automatically recording, transcribing, and summarizing your meetings. You just need to invite the AI bot, the rest happens automatically.

    Who is behind Fireflies?

    Fireflies.ai Corp. was founded in 2016 by Krish Ramineni and Sam Udotong in Pleasanton, United States. It actually started as something completely different: a drone delivery service. Later they tried it as an NLP tool for task management. But both ideas didn’t work as hoped.

    The breakthrough came when the founders themselves got frustrated with manually taking notes during meetings. They hated the process and realized others probably had the same problem. So they pivoted to meeting transcription. That choice proved to be golden.

    Today, Fireflies has more than 20 million users and is used by 75% of Fortune 500 companies. The company has raised $ 19 million, with Khosla Ventures and Canaan Partners as key investors. They process billions of minutes of meetings and even reached unicorn status in 2024/2025. From failed drone delivery to a billion-dollar company – pretty impressive.

    Who is Fireflies for?

    Fireflies is built for anyone who has a lot of online meetings. Sales teams can review conversations to improve their pitch. Recruiters can transcribe interviews without constantly typing. Managers automatically get action items from team meetings. Remote teams can watch missed meetings later.

    But it’s not suitable for everyone. If you don’t have many online meetings, you’re paying for something you barely use. And if you require 100% on-device processing for privacy reasons, you’re better off looking at alternatives. Fireflies sends a bot to your meeting that uploads everything to their servers.

    What can Fireflies do?

    The free version offers automatic transcription, basic AI summaries, and searchable text. For extensive CRM integrations, unlimited storage, and video recording, you need a paid plan. Here are the main features:

    • Automatic transcription: Fireflies records your meetings and converts them to text. Works with Zoom, Google Meet, Microsoft Teams and other platforms. You only need to invite the bot through your calendar.
    • AI Super Summaries: Afterwards you get a summary with the key points, decisions and action items. Useful when you want to quickly know what was discussed without reading the entire transcript.
    • AskFred (AI assistant chat): You can ask questions about your meetings. For example: “What were the action items for Mark?” or “When did we talk about the budget?” Fred looks it up for you.
    • Smart Search filters: Search by keywords, speakers, date or sentiment. For example, you can find all the times someone mentioned “deadline,” or all the negative reactions in a conversation.
    • Creating Soundbites clips: Cut important clips from your meetings and share them with your team. Ideal for onboarding, training or sharing feedback.
    • CRM and Slack integrations: Connect Fireflies to Salesforce, HubSpot or Slack. Transcriptions and summaries are automatically shared with your team or saved in your CRM.

    Fireflies works on web, iOS, Android, Windows, and macOS. Linux is not supported. The tool recognizes more than 69 languages, including Dutch, although AI summaries are sometimes generated in English.

    What does Fireflies cost?

    Fireflies has a free plan with 800 minutes of storage and limited AI summaries. That’s enough to test the tool, but for regular use you’ll quickly run into the limits.

    The Pro plan costs $ 18 per month or $ 10 per month if you pay annually (total $ 120). This gets you unlimited transcription, advanced AI summaries, and more storage space. The Business plan costs $ 29 per month or $ 19 per month with annual payment (total $ 228). That plan adds video recording, CRM integrations, and team features.

    A 7-day trial period is available for the paid plans. Lifetime deals are not offered.

    What should you watch out for?

    Fireflies has its limitations. The speaker identification is often inaccurate, especially in larger meetings with many participants. You have to manually correct who said what regularly. That takes time and undermines part of the automation.

    The transcription struggles with accents and jargon. If your team uses technical terms or industry-specific words, there are often errors in those. The same goes for non-standard accents. The text is usable, but not perfect.

    There is no automatic language detection. You have to set in advance what language the meeting is in, otherwise you get a messy transcription. Difficult when you have meetings that switch between languages.

    Some users find the presence of the bot disruptive. It appears as a participant in your meeting, which sometimes raises questions with external guests. You can’t make the bot invisible.

    Fireflies alternatives

    Fireflies is not the only player in this market. Here are three alternatives you can consider:

    • Otter.ai: Choose this if you find real-time transcription during the meeting important. Otter displays the text live while people are talking, which is useful for the hearing impaired or if you want to read along immediately.
    • tl;dv: This alternative has a stronger free plan with video recording included. If your budget is limited and video is important to you, tl;dv is a better choice.
    • Fathom: Completely free for individual users. If you’re looking for a simple, no-nonsense solution without a paywall, try Fathom.

    Does Fireflies work with Dutch meetings?

    Yes, Fireflies supports transcription in more than 69 languages, including Dutch. The AI summaries are sometimes generated in English, even though the meeting was in Dutch. That can be confusing.

    How does Fireflies join my meeting?

    Fireflies adds a bot ([email protected]) to your calendar invitations. That bot automatically dials into Zoom, Google Meet or Teams calls at the scheduled time. You see it as a participant in the meeting.

    Is my data safe with Fireflies?

    Data is stored by default in the United States and the company is SOC 2 Type II compliant. Enterprise customers can choose Private Storage to store data in the EU, but that’s not available for standard plans.

    Conclusion

    Fireflies does what it promises: automatically transcribe meetings and make them searchable. The AI summaries are useful and the integrations with CRM systems work well. For sales teams and managers who have a lot of meetings, it really saves time.

    But the speaker identification is mediocre and the transcription stumbles over accents. If you expect perfect accuracy, you’ll be disappointed. For those who have few meetings or conduct privacy-sensitive conversations, there are better options. But for the average remote worker who wants to automate their notes? Then Fireflies is a solid choice.
